The Secret's in the Spin

Okay, so here's the deal. Your ceiling fan isn't just a dusty decoration hanging precariously from above. It's a powerful tool, a silent warrior in the battle against sweltering heat. But only if you know how to wield it properly.

In the summertime, you want your ceiling fan to spin counter-clockwise. Why? I'm so glad you asked!

When the fan blades rotate counter-clockwise, they push air downwards. This creates a lovely, refreshing breeze that you can actually feel. It's like a mini-tornado of coolness swirling around your living room. Who wouldn't want that?

How to Tell Which Way It's Spinning (Without Getting Dizzy)

Alright, let's say you're staring up at your ceiling fan, and you're not entirely sure which way it's spinning. Don't worry, it happens to the best of us. Here are a couple of foolproof methods:

Method 1: The Eyeball Test. Stand directly beneath the fan and watch the blades. Are they moving to the left (counter-clockwise) or to the right (clockwise)? Sometimes, it's just that simple! (But if you're like me and easily get confused, proceed to Method 2.)

Method 2: The Arm Test. (Okay, I made up that name, but it sounds cool, right?) Hold your arm out to the side. Does the air feel like it's being pushed down onto your arm? If so, you're in business! If not, it's time for some adjustments.

The Switcheroo: Changing the Fan's Direction

Most ceiling fans have a little switch located on the motor housing. It's often a small slide switch, and it can be a little tricky to find. (Seriously, sometimes they hide these things on purpose!) But persevere, you'll find it!

Important safety tip: Make sure the fan is turned off before you try to flip the switch. We don't want any unexpected ceiling fan blade encounters. Nobody wants a ceiling fan related injury.

Once you've located the switch, simply slide it to the opposite position. Then, turn the fan back on and watch it go! (Remember to use one of the testing methods above to confirm you've done it correctly.)

Why Does This Even Matter?

Besides the obvious coolness factor (pun intended), setting your ceiling fan to spin counter-clockwise in the summer can actually save you money. Yep, you read that right! By circulating the air more effectively, you can often turn your thermostat up a few degrees without sacrificing comfort.

In the winter, you want your ceiling fan to spin clockwise at a low speed. This pulls the warm air that rises to the ceiling back down into the room, helping to even out the temperature. It's like a cozy, comforting hug from your ceiling fan. And again, this helps to save energy.
